Best Bet: Edwards over 25.5 points (-108)

Embed: #112488

The Timberwolves have a wide range of outcomes today. But one thing is certain: If they win, they’ll avoid the play-in tournament.

That shouldn’t be too much to ask against the lowly Utah Jazz — especially with a red-hot Edwards leading the charge.

  • Over his last seven games, Edwards averaged 28.9 points and scored 25+ six times.
  • He’s taking a ton of shots, attempting 19.6 field goals per game during that time, while shooting above 50%.
  • Plus, he’s been lighting it up from deep, attempting 11.0 3-pointers and making 4.3 a night (39.0%).

This is practically a playoff game for the T-Wolves, and Edwards has proven to be the go-to guy for them.

The Jazz have the worst defensive rating in the NBA (121.1). They also allow the second-most points per game to shooting guards (24.14), per Fantasy Pros.

Key stat: Edwards has scored 30-plus points against Utah in six straight games dating back to 2023.

LaVine over 22.5 points (-118): Like the T-Wolves, the Sacramento Kings can decide their fate as well.

No matter what, the Kings will play the Dallas Mavericks in the play-in, but Sacramento can guarantee that the contest is played at home with a win over the Phoenix Suns.

Phoenix will be without Devin Booker, Kevin Durant and Bradley Beal, so this is a prime spot for the Kings to grab a win.

And that effort should be spearheaded by LaVine with how he’s played over the last five games:

  • 31.6 PPG
  • 22.2 FGA
  • 53.2 FG%
  • 55.1 3PT%

What piques my interest the most, though, is his 5.4 made 3s per night over that timeframe.

His immense volume and MVP-calibre efficiency provide a very reliable floor at the moment.

Jokic to record a triple-double (+116): The last team I’ll highlight is the Denver Nuggets.

They can secure the fourth seed by simply beating the Houston Rockets. That task would usually be difficult, but the Rockets should be resting a lot of their key players to prepare for the postseason.

This could also go really poorly for Denver. A loss and an unlucky mixture of results around the league would drop the squad into the play-in tournament.

That’s why I expect Jokic to step up and have a big game for his team.

Well, actually, he would only need a standard performance; the big man averages a triple-double (29.8 points, 12.8 rebounds, 10.3 assists).

That includes cashing this wager in five of the past eight games. Two of the three times he fell short, he finished one assist shy.
